Christian Video Game Creator Refuses to Cave to Cancel Culture: ‘I Will Not Apologize’

June 15, 2021 by Staff

(Faithwire) Scott Cawthon, creator of popular video game “Five Nights at Freddy’s” is refusing to back down after people searched for his name on Open Secrets and doxxed for donating to Donald Trump and other Republicans.

As reported by The Daily Wire, Cawthon’s donations and political views became subject of fodder for gaming site GameRant, which highlighted the fact that fans of the video game series “are concerned and hurt to find out where the money Cawthon makes from the popular horror series is going.”
